John Wall, Projected No.1 NBA Draft Pick, Signs $25-Million Deal With Reebok

Comments (1)

Kentucky guard and projected No. 1 NBA Draft pick John Wall hasn't even stepped on an NBA court yet and he's got his first million-dollar endorsement contract. According to Yahoo! Sports, Wall signed a $25-million five-year endorsement deal with Reebok. Reebok is hoping that Wall will be the new face of its basketball brand, taking the place of Allen Iverson who's had a deal with the company for more than a decade.
Apparently the deal guarantees Wall two lines of signature shoes. His deal is the largest for a No. 1 pick since LeBron James signed his $90-million deal with Nike before he was drafted. Even though he doesn't have as much buzz as LeBron James leading in to the draft, Wall is expected to make an immediate impact to the Washington Wizards (who have the first pick in the draft).


In comparison, 2009's No. 1 draft pick, Blake Griffin, signed a $400,000 endorsement deal with Nike. Wall is 6'4", 195 pounds and averaged 16 points, 6.5 assists, 4.3 rebounds and 1.8 steals a game while he was with Kentucky.
